// Configuration template file to // playback spectral data files // Do not Modify this section [GLOBAL] { sLapxmVersion = '2.5.0.0'; } [DWELLMODES]{MODENAME=WA{}} [DWELLLIST]{D={'WA/0'};} [DWELLSEQUENCE]{REPEAT{Acquire(DL0);}FOREVER;} // End do not modify [PROCESSES] { [TsWA, SpecWA, MomWA, TsWB, SpecWB, MomWB, TsWC, SpecWC, MomWC, TsWD, SpecWD, MomWD, TsRASS, SpecRASS, MomRASS] = PlayBack(NULL) { iProcessSpeedSec = 0; // seconds to wait between processing dwells iProcessSpeedMilliSec = 100; // milliseconds to wait between processing dwells sPath = 'D:\LapxmData\SpecMom'; // directory path for input file sFile = 'D07056a.spc'; // complete name of file // sFile = {'D07267a.spc','D07281a.spc'}; // process a list of files // sFile = 'D07*.spc'; // use wildcard notation to process multiple files // sDateRange = {'07200','07280'}; // optional parameter to define specific date range sOLEID = 'LAPXM.PlayBack.1'; }; [SpecWA_IR, SpecWB_IR, SpecWC_IR, SpecWD_IR, SpecRASS_IR] = InterferenceReduction(NULL,{SpecWA, SpecWB, SpecWC, SpecWD, SpecRASS}) { iUseRiddleGCRemoval = {1, 1, 1, 1, 1}; fClutterHeightKm = {1.0, 1.2, 1.2, 1.2, 0.8}; sOLEID = 'Lapxm.Spectra_InterferenceReduction.1'; }; [MomWA_RP, MomWB_RP, MomWC_RP, MomWD_RP, MomRASS_RP] = Moments(NULL,{SpecWA_IR, SpecWB_IR, SpecWC_IR, SpecWD_IR, SpecRASS_IR}) { sOLEID = 'Lapxm.Moments.1'; }; ConsoleDisplay(NULL, NULL, {SpecWA,SpecWB,SpecWC,SpecWD,SpecRASS}, {MomWA_RP,MomWB_RP,MomWC_RP,MomWD_RP,MomRASS_RP}) { sOLEID = 'Lapxm.ConsoleDisplay.1'; }; PopArchive(NULL, NULL, {SpecWA, SpecWB, SpecWC, SpecWD, SpecRASS}, {MomWA_RP, MomWB_RP, MomWC_RP, MomWD_RP, MomRASS_RP}) { iAppend = 1; iWriteMoments = 1; iWriteSpectral = 1; iWriteTimeSeries = 0; iPopCompliant = 1; sPath = 'D:\LapxmData\Reprocess\SpecMom'; sOLEID = 'LAPXM.PopArchiver.1'; }; [CnsWA] = Consensus_WindTemp_WA(NULL,{MomWA_RP},{MomWA_RP, MomWB_RP, MomWC_RP, MomWD_RP, MomRASS_RP}) { iUseRunningConsensus = 0; iConsenseOnStop = 1; iConsenseOnMinute = {25, 55}; iCnsIntervalCycles = 5; iCnsLengthCycles = 10; fDeltaT = 0.0; fDeltaTc = 0.0; fDeltaUV = 3.0; fDeltaW = 3.0; fPctDataT = 0.0; fPctDataTc = 0.0; fPctDataUV = 60.0; fPctDataW = 60.0; iVerticalCorrect = 1; iUseObliqueBeamsForVertical = 1; iUseVerticalObliqueRangeCorrection = 1; iCheckConsensusSpan = 1; sMethod = 'mean'; sTimeStamp = 'begin'; sOLEID = 'Lapxm.Consensus_WindTemp.1'; }; [CnsWB] = Consensus_WindTemp_WB(NULL,{MomWB_RP},{MomWA_RP, MomWB_RP, MomWC_RP, MomWD_RP, MomRASS_RP}) { iUseRunningConsensus = 0; iConsenseOnStop = 1; iConsenseOnMinute = {25, 55}; iCnsIntervalCycles = 5; iCnsLengthCycles = 10; fDeltaT = 0.0; fDeltaTc = 0.0; fDeltaUV = 3.0; fDeltaW = 3.0; fPctDataT = 0.0; fPctDataTc = 0.0; fPctDataUV = 60.0; fPctDataW = 60.0; iVerticalCorrect = 1; iUseObliqueBeamsForVertical = 1; iUseVerticalObliqueRangeCorrection = 1; iCheckConsensusSpan = 1; sMethod = 'mean'; sTimeStamp = 'begin'; sOLEID = 'Lapxm.Consensus_WindTemp.1'; }; [CnsWC] = Consensus_WindTemp_WC(NULL,{MomWC_RP},{MomWA_RP, MomWB_RP, MomWC_RP, MomWD_RP, MomRASS_RP}) { iUseRunningConsensus = 0; iConsenseOnStop = 1; iConsenseOnMinute = {25, 55}; iCnsIntervalCycles = 5; iCnsLengthCycles = 10; fDeltaT = 0.0; fDeltaTc = 0.0; fDeltaUV = 3.0; fDeltaW = 3.0; fPctDataT = 0.0; fPctDataTc = 0.0; fPctDataUV = 60.0; fPctDataW = 60.0; iVerticalCorrect = 1; iUseObliqueBeamsForVertical = 1; iUseVerticalObliqueRangeCorrection = 1; iCheckConsensusSpan = 1; sMethod = 'mean'; sTimeStamp = 'begin'; sOLEID = 'Lapxm.Consensus_WindTemp.1'; }; [CnsWD] = Consensus_WindTemp_WD(NULL,{MomWD_RP},{MomWA_RP, MomWB_RP, MomWC_RP, MomWD_RP, MomRASS_RP}) { iUseRunningConsensus = 0; iConsenseOnStop = 1; iConsenseOnMinute = {25, 55}; iCnsIntervalCycles = 5; iCnsLengthCycles = 10; fDeltaT = 0.0; fDeltaTc = 0.0; fDeltaUV = 3.0; fDeltaW = 3.0; fPctDataT = 0.0; fPctDataTc = 0.0; fPctDataUV = 60.0; fPctDataW = 60.0; iVerticalCorrect = 1; iUseObliqueBeamsForVertical = 1; iUseVerticalObliqueRangeCorrection = 1; iCheckConsensusSpan = 1; sMethod = 'mean'; sTimeStamp = 'begin'; sOLEID = 'Lapxm.Consensus_WindTemp.1'; }; [CnsRASS] = Consensus_WindTemp_RASS(NULL,{MomRASS_RP},{MomWA_RP, MomWB_RP, MomWC_RP, MomWD_RP, MomRASS_RP}) { iUseRunningConsensus = 0; iConsenseOnStop = 1; iConsenseOnMinute = {0, 30}; iCnsIntervalCycles = 5; iCnsLengthCycles = 10; fDeltaT = 2.0; fDeltaTc = 2.0; fDeltaUV = 0.0; fDeltaW = 3.0; fPctDataT = 60.0; fPctDataTc = 60.0; fPctDataUV = 0.0; fPctDataW = 60.0; iVerticalCorrect = 1; iUseObliqueBeamsForVertical = 1; iUseVerticalObliqueRangeCorrection = 1; iCheckConsensusSpan = 1; sMethod = 'mean'; sTimeStamp = 'begin'; sOLEID = 'Lapxm.Consensus_WindTemp.1'; }; Archive_Cns_Text(NULL,{CnsWA, CnsWB, CnsWC, CnsWD, CnsRASS}) { iWrite = 1; iPopCompliant = 0; iWrite_Radials = 1; iWrite_SNR = 1; iWrite_CCounts = 1; iWrite_UVW = 0; iWrite_QC = 0; sPath = 'D:\LAPXMDATA\Reprocess\WindTemp'; sOLEID = 'Lapxm.Archive_Cns_Text.1'; }; Archive_Cns_DB(NULL, {CnsWA, CnsWB, CnsWC, CnsWD, CnsRASS}) { iWrite = 1; sDescription = 'Four winds and RASS'; sPath = 'D:\LapxmData\Reprocess\DB\LapxmCnsDb.mdb'; sOLEID = 'Lapxm.Archive_Cns_DB.1'; }; }